The club of the capital deplores this Friday the death of Cédric Dupuis, a physiotherapist of the club. He was 48 years old.
The PSG announced the disappearance of an esteemed member of its medical team. Cédric Dupuis, a physiotherapist at the training centre, died at the age of 48.
